Binance App Advantages

Trade Anytime, Anywhere

The biggest advantage of the mobile app is portability. Whether you're on the subway, at a restaurant, or traveling, you can check prices and trade by simply pulling out your phone.

Push Notifications

The app lets you set price alerts and trade notifications. When prices hit your target levels, you'll receive instant push messages so you never miss an opportunity.

Biometric Login

The app supports fingerprint and facial recognition login, which is faster and more convenient than typing a password every time.

Seamless P2P Trading

Buying and selling crypto via P2P is smoother on the app, and uploading payment proof photos is easier.

QR Code Scanning

The app supports scanning QR codes for quick transfers or adding addresses, eliminating the hassle of manually entering long wallet addresses.

Web Version Advantages

Larger Screen

A computer screen offers more space to simultaneously view candlestick charts, order books, and trade history for multiple trading pairs.

Professional Charting Tools

The web version's TradingView charting tools are more powerful than the app's, supporting more technical indicators and drawing tools — ideal for technical analysis.

Multi-Tab Operation

You can open multiple browser tabs simultaneously — one for BTC prices and another for ETH — and switch easily between them.

Faster Keyboard Input

Entering prices and quantities via keyboard is faster and more accurate than typing on a phone, especially when you need to place orders quickly.

No Installation Required

The web version doesn't require any software installation — just open a browser. It doesn't take up phone storage space.

Desktop Client

Binance also offers desktop clients for Windows and Mac that combine the advantages of both the app and web version:

  • Large-screen workspace
  • Professional charting tools
  • Standalone application unaffected by browser issues
  • System notifications support

If you frequently trade on a computer, the desktop client is a great option.

Recommendations by Scenario

Checking prices and simple trades: App

For most users, the app is more than sufficient. Common operations like checking prices, spot trading, and earning products all work smoothly.

Technical analysis and professional trading: Web or Desktop Client

If you need to draw trendlines, analyze technical indicators, or monitor multiple trading pairs simultaneously, the desktop experience is superior.

Futures trading: Desktop recommended

Futures trading demands quick reactions and precise inputs, making keyboard controls and large-screen displays more suitable.

P2P buying/selling: App

P2P trading involves transfer screenshots and real-time communication, which are more convenient on a phone.

Security Comparison

From a security perspective, each platform has its characteristics:

  • App: Supports biometric login, but phones can be lost
  • Web: Susceptible to phishing website attacks — always verify the URL
  • Desktop Client: Relatively secure, though computers can be infected by viruses

Regardless of which platform you use, enabling two-factor authentication (2FA) to protect your account is recommended.

FAQ

Are the fees the same on the app and web version?

Exactly the same. Fee structures are uniform regardless of which platform you use.

Can I see orders placed on the app in the web version?

Yes. All platforms share the same account — orders, assets, and trade history are all synchronized.

Does the web version require browser plugins?

No. Simply open the Binance website in any mainstream browser (Chrome, Firefox, Safari, Edge) to use it.

Which version gets updates faster?

Generally, the app and web version are updated at a similar pace, with new features typically launching simultaneously. Occasionally, certain features may debut on one platform first.
